    In How To Interview A Sales Rep, John P. Davis explores how the hiring tactics that most managers think will work for them are actually failing them. Many will qualify candidates subjectively, based on feeling alone. Others rely on outdated techniques, which can be misleading in today's market. These patterns allow poor hiring to persist, which has a direct effect on a company's balance sheet. In this book, John will show you a better way.

    John introduces an interview method that is not for the faint of heart. It removes the subjectivity of a sales interview and focuses exclusively on deal discussions and professionalism. John's method creates stronger, more objective filters that will enable you to become more confident when hiring.

    You will learn to eliminate emotions to obtain results that you can bring to your senior leadership. You will develop a process for interviewing salespeople that highlights the intangibles of selling while eliminating weaker candidates. You will also improve your decision-making and learn how to find the best sales rep possible - every single time.

    How To Get A Sales Job is a must-read for anyone in search of a new sales job. It’s an affordable tool filled with best practices, real-life examples, and anecdotes that’ll prepare you for any situation you encounter along the way. Whether you're a beginner or a seasoned sales rep, having a repeatable process in place will give you an edge over other candidates and increase your likelihood of finding the right sales job. You’ll learn how to Turn your Resume into a High-Powered Sales Tool, Establish a Professional Sales Brand, Build a List of Target Companies, Utilize the Best Contact Methods and Master the Interview Process.
